Search web search Home Singapore Asia Pacific World Business Entertainment Sports Technology US-TECH Summary Reuters - Saturday, September 4 Send IM Story Print Google faces Texas AG inquiry, settles privacy suit SAN FRANCISCO - Google Inc <GOOG.O> said on Friday it was the target of an investigation by the Texas Attorney General's office into the fairness of its search engine rankings. The world No. 1 search engine company said the probe is the first by a U.S. legal authority into the fairness of its rankings, which can make or break commercial websites. U.S. and Israel spying behind BlackBerry woe: Dubai police DUBAI - Concerns over Israeli access to BlackBerry data, and the use of the device by the United States to spy on the United Arab Emirates are behind the Gulf state's moves to curb the smartphone, Dubai's police chief said. "The Unites States is the primary beneficiary of having no controls over the BlackBerry, as it has an interest to spy on the UAE," Dhahi Khalfan Tamim said in remarks carried by the website of the daily al-Khaleej on Friday. Samsung to challenge Apple's iPad with own tablet BERLIN - Samsung Electronics' <005930.KS> first tablet computer, the Galaxy Tab, will go on sale in two weeks, it said on Thursday, turning up the heat on Apple Inc's <AAPL.O> iPad. Global handset vendors and PC makers including Nokia <NOK1V.HE>, LG Electronics <066570.KS> and Hewlett-Packard Co <HPQ.N> are moving into the new category of devices, between traditional PCs and smartphones, taking a cue from Apple. Apple and Google to clash in music space by Christmas NEW YORK - Google Inc <GOOG.O> is in talks with music labels on plans for a download store and a digital song locker that would allow its mobile users to play songs wherever they are as it steps up its rivalry with Apple Inc <AAPL.O>, according to people familiar with the matter. Google's Andy Rubin, the brains behind Google's Android mobile operating system, has been leading conversations with the labels about what a new Google music service would look like, according to these sources. Apple TV could help Netflix growth LOS ANGELES - Shares in Netflix Inc <NFLX.O> neared their all-time high on Thursday, after Apple Inc <AAPL.O> said that the company's streaming video service would be added to a new version of Apple TV. The tie-in with Apple TV, a smaller, cheaper version of Apple's earlier web-to-TV product, could cement Netflix's dominance in the online movie rental business. Verizon unveils prepaid option for smartphones NEW YORK - Verizon Wireless on Thursday started giving smartphone users the option of paying for calls in advance instead of committing to long-term contracts, a move that pits it directly against rivals like Leap Wireless <LEAP.O>. Prepaid services have become more popular in the last few years among consumers looking to avoid the long-term contract commitments that come with postpaid contracts. HP wins 3PAR for $2.4 billion as Dell drops out NEW YORK - Hewlett-Packard Co <HPQ.N> won the bidding war to buy data storage company 3PAR Inc <PAR.N> for $2.4 billion, as rival Dell Inc <DELL.O> bowed out on Thursday. HP raised its cash offer by $3 to $33 per share, beating Dell's $32-a-share offer and ending an escalation of bids that many analysts said had gone too far. Panasonic aiming for half of Europe's 3D TV market BERLIN - Panasonic Corp <6752.T> is aiming to grab a 50 percent share of the European 3D television market this year as demand outstrips expectations and the technology wins converts worldwide, its head of Europe said on Thursday. The company expects sales of 3D televisions to generate 15-20 percent of its revenue in Europe this year, Laurent Abadie told Reuters in an interview ahead of the start of consumer electronics trade show IFA in Berlin. Apple TV a first step for more ambitious plans? LOS ANGELES - Critics hoping for more from Apple Inc's <AAPL.O> Web-to-TV plans -- a device, say, that would revolutionize living room entertainment the way the iPad changed tablet computing -- may just need to wait a bit longer. Shortly after Apple unveiled its latest Apple TV product on Wednesday, complaints surfaced from some circles that the company had failed to live up to its own high standards. The device is smaller and cheaper than the one it brought out in 2006, but it also has shortcomings. Apple and TV networks clash over 99 cent rentals NEW YORK - Apple Inc <AAPL.O> introduced a new version of Apple TV on Wednesday with shows from just two networks, underscoring its struggles to win over a media industry worried about losing control over the pricing of its programs. The new $99 Apple TV will allow users to rent TV shows such as "Glee" and "Modern Family" for 99 cents thanks to partnerships with Walt Disney Co's <DIS.N> ABC and News Corp's <NWSA.O> Fox.
